Just as we inherit our blood type “letter” from our parents, we inherit the Rh factor from them as well. Each person has two Rh factors in their genetics, one from each parent.

WebWhen a mother-to-be and father-to-be are not both positive or negative for Rh factor, it's called Rh incompatibility. For example: If a woman who is Rh negative and a man who is Rh positive conceive a baby, the fetus may have Rh-positive blood, inherited from the father. WebMan kan have blodtyperne rhesus positiv (foroven) eller rhesus negativ (forneden). Kvinder med blodtypen rhesus positiv (foroven) har ingen risiko for immunisering, heller ikke hvis hun bærer et barn der er rhesus negativt. Men hvis moderens blodtype er rhesus negativ og barnets er rhesus positiv kan immunisering potentielt opstå.
